Israeli prime minister’s visit comes amid the Gaza war and a US presidential race.
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u was welcomed by a cheering US Congress this week as thousands of people took to the streets in Washington, DC, to protest against Israel’s nine-month-old war on Gaza.
How is Netanyahu’s visit being viewed in the US and in Israel?
